St Mary's College Pasifika Roots 2020
The SMC Pasifika Student and Parent Committee are proud to present their first ever Pasifika Roots Talanoa. This is a free event which will be held on Saturday 18 July in the St Mary’s College Cecilia Maher Hall here at 11 New Street, Ponsonby, Auckland.
The aim of the Talanoa is to provide support for young people to help them thrive at school and within their families and communities. There will be wonderful guest speakers including past pupils Lupesina Koro and Nele Kalolo, as well as food and entertainment.
